Fonterra units lead slide in listed dairy companies; A2, Synlait fall
Aug 5 (BusinessDesk) – Units of Fonterra Shareholders’ Fund tumbled to the lowest level this year, leading a decline in dairy-related companies on the NZX, amid investor concern earnings will suffer from the discovery of a bacteria contamination in batches of whey protein. Units of the fund, which give investors access to the dividends from Fonterra’s shares, fell 8.6 percent to $6.51, erasing more than $60 million from its market value.
